Skip to content

Conversation

haijianyang
Copy link
Contributor

@haijianyang haijianyang commented Aug 4, 2025

Change

Management Cluster: v1.28.x -> v1.32.x
Workload Cluster: v1.26.x -> v1.32.x

Bump

  • go v1.23.11
  • controller-runtime v0.19.6
  • controller-gen v0.16.1

New

  • KubeadmControlPlane: Implement pre-terminate hook for clean Machine Deletion (#11137)
  • KubeadmControlPlane: NamingStrategy for Machines (#11123)
  • Update
  • MachineSet/MachineDeployment: Foreground deletion for MachineDeployments and MachineSets (#11174)
  • Improve Node drain observability (#11074 #11121)
  • MachineDrainRules Configurable Machine drain behavior (#11240)
  • top waiting for detachment of volumes belonging to Pods ignored during drain (#11246 #11386)
  • Deprecation
  • API: Deprecated FailureMessage and FailureReason fields (#11317)
  • The ClusterCacheTracker component has been deprecated (#11312 #11340), please use the new ClusterCache instead.

Breaking

  • Machine: Ignore attached Volumes referred by pods ignored during drain (#11246)

Fix

  • Machine: Machine Controller should try to retrieve node on delete (#11032)

Test

通过了 E2E 测试。

@haijianyang haijianyang merged commit 7ca704b into master Aug 5, 2025
3 checks passed
@haijianyang haijianyang deleted the capi-1.9.x branch August 5, 2025 05:26
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ment

Labels

None yet

Projects

None yet

Development

Successfully merging this pull request may close these issues.

1 participant